Hiyas,

My home has a gas furnace with forced hot water base boards. It's relatively new 2003.
The problem is it has Taco esp zone valves 3 zones all have been replaced at least once.
The HVAC company that did the original work replaced them saying Taco improved the motor. Well I have 2 burned out motors that can't turn the ball valve.

What should I do replace them with the same or get a new valve system?

you probably have too many zone valves on a transformer, or the transformer does not have enough amperage. The valves themselves are quite dependable.

There are 3 zones and the power supply is from taco also it has 4 zone capability and is 24vac. After some research they have discontinued the ESP and are now called EBV. Same concept with a better motor from what I can tell.
Taco is sending me 2 new motors for free so I hope they work.
